实现不同种类即时通信工具互通的方法和系统的制作方法

文档序号:7689110阅读:169来源:国知局
专利名称:实现不同种类即时通信工具互通的方法和系统的制作方法
技术领域
本发明涉及即时通信技术,尤其涉及实现多种不同种类即时通信工具之间进行互通的方法和系统。
背景技术
即时通信服务(IM,Instant Messenger)是一种基于网络的通信服务,一般以实现网络上的即时通信功能为主。即时通信工具是指实现即时通信服务的软件,例如目前用户广泛使用的即时通信工具包括QQ,MSN, Skype和飞信等。由于即时通信工具的灵活方便,在网络上得到了大量的应用,成为了用户在网络生活中必不可少的工具。可以说,经常上网的大部分用户都有自己的即时通信帐号。但是,随着即时通信服务的发展,很多公司都推出了自己的即时通信工具,如现在应用广泛的QQ,MSN, Skype和飞信等等,而这些不同种类的即时通信工具之间却又不能互联互通,导致用户需要在不同种类的即时通信服务器上注册,申请帐号,下载不同种类的即时通信客户端,安装在自己的计算机上,并运行这些不同种类的即时通信客户端,维护多个不同种类的好友列表。可以说,现在很多网络用户都有好几个不同种类的即时通信帐号,用户需要同时使用和维护这好几个不同种类的即时通信客户端,非常不方便,又极大的浪费了宝贵的计算机资源。

发明内容
本发明的目的在于解决上述问题,提供了一种实现不同种类即时通讯工具互通的方法,以方便网络用户之间的即时通信,使得网络用户可以只选择某个自己偏好的即时通信工具使用,而又可以跟其它种类的即时通信工具互联互通。本发明的另一目的在于提供了一种实现不同种类即时通讯工具互通的系统。本发明的技术方案为本发明揭示了一种实现不同种类即时通信工具互通的方法,包括步骤1 架设即时通信交换中心,支持多种不同的即时通信工具;步骤2 第一用户在所述即时通信交换中心注册用户名和自己的即时通信工具的种类和帐号;步骤3 所述第一用户用注册的所述即时通信工具和所述帐号与所述即时通信交换中心通信,指定作为通信对方的第二用户在所述即时通信交换中心的用户名或者所述第二用户的即时通信工具的种类和帐号;步骤4:所述即时通信交换中心通知所述第二用户有关所述第一用户的通信请求;步骤5 所述第二用户同意所述第一用户的通信请求,双方开始通信,所述即时通信交换中心在中间交换和中继双方的通信内容。根据本发明的实现不同种类即时通信工具互通的方法的一实施例,所述步骤1包括步骤1. 1 所述即时通信交换中心申请多个不同的即时通信帐号;步骤1.2 所述即时通信交换中心运行多个即时通信客户端,连接到相应的即时通信服务器,并向自己的用户提供即时通信交换服务。根据本发明的实现不同种类即时通信工具互通的方法的一实施例,所述步骤2包括所述第一用户在注册自己的即时通信工具的种类和帐号时,将所述即时通信交换中心提供的该种即时通信服务帐号加为好友或者联系人,以便使用后续所述即时通信交换中心提供的服务。根据本发明的实现不同种类即时通信工具互通的方法的一实施例,所述步骤3包括步骤3. 1 所述第一用户使用注册的即时通信工具和帐号,与所述即时通信交换中心的与所述第一用户所使用的所述即时通信工具属于相同种类的即时通信服务帐号通信;步骤3.2 所述第一用户用所述即时通信工具,指定所述第二用户在所述即时通信交换中心的用户名或者所述第二用户的即时通信工具的种类和帐号。根据本发明的实现不同种类即时通信工具互通的方法的一实施例,所述步骤4包括以下两种情况中的其中一种所述即时通信交换中心根据所述第一用户提供的所述第二用户的用户名在所述即时通信交换中心查询所述第二用户的即时通信工具的种类和帐号,然后在查询到的即时通信工具和帐号上将所述第一用户的通信请求通知给所述第二用户;或者所述即时通信交换中心根据所述第一用户提供的所述第二用户的即时通信工具的种类和帐号,在所述第二用户相应的所述即时通信工具和帐号上将所述第一用户的通信请求通知给所述第二用户。根据本发明的实现不同种类即时通信工具互通的方法的一实施例,所述步骤5包括步骤5. 1 所述第一用户在其第一即时通信工具上输入通信内容,发送到所述即时通信交换中心的所述第一即时通信工具的服务帐号上;步骤5. 2 所述即时通信交换中心获取到所述第一用户在所述第一即时通信工具上发送的通信内容后,将其发送到所述第二用户的第二即时通信工具上;步骤5.3 所述第二用户在所述第二即时通信工具上输入通信内容,发送到所述即时通信交换中心的所述第二即时通信工具的服务帐号上;步骤5. 4 所述即时通信交换中心获取到所述第二用户在所述第二即时通信工具上发送的通信内容后,将其发送到所述第一用户的所述第一即时通信工具上。根据本发明的实现不同种类即时通信工具互通的方法的一实施例,所述多种不同的即时通信工具包括QQ、MSN、Skype、飞信。本发明还揭示了一种实现不同种类即时通信工具互通的系统,包括多个客户端,包括安装版,网页版或者手机版,分属于多种不同的即时通信工具;
多个即时通信服务器,分属于多种不同的即时通信工具,与其对应的客户端之间建立通信连接;即时通信交换中心,其中设置多个对应不同种类即时通信工具的交换和中继模块,每一交换和中继模块和对应的所述多个即时通信服务器建立通信连接,所述即时通信交换中心在不同种类的即时通信工具的即时通信服务器之间交换和中继双方的通信内容。根据本发明的实现不同种类即时通信工具互通的系统的一实施例,所述多种不同的即时通信工具包括QQ、MSN、Skype、飞信。本发明对比现有技术有如下的有益效果本发明的方案是架设即时通信交换中心,支持多种不同的即时通信工具;第一用户在即时通信交换中心注册用户名和自己的即时通信工具的种类和帐号;第一用户用注册的即时通信工具和帐号与即时通信交换中心通信,指定作为通信对方的第二用户在即时通信交换中心的用户名或者第二用户的即时通信工具的种类和帐号;即时通信交换中心通知第二用户有关所述第一用户的通信请求;第二用户同意所述第一用户的通信请求,双方开始通信,所述即时通信交换中心在中间交换和中继双方的通信内容。对比现有技术,本发明的方案存在如下优点通过支持多种不同即时通信工具的交换服务中心在中间交换和中继通信双方的通信内容,不同种类的即时通信工具就可以方便地实现互通,用户可以在多个即时通信工具之间切换,或者选择使用自己最喜欢的即时通信工具,跟其他不同种类的即时通信工具通信。用户也可以不再需要申请多个即时通信工具帐号,登录多个即时通信客户端,维护多个好友列表。其次,本方法直接使用不同种类即时通信工具提供的免费服务,支持多种即时通信工具之间的互通,所以即时通信交换中心的架设成本非常低。


图1示出了本发明的实现不同种类即时通信工具互通的方法的第一实施例的流程图。图2示出了本发明的实现不同种类即时通信工具互通的方法的第二实施例的流程图。图3示出了本发明的实现不同种类即时通信工具互通的系统的实施例的结构图。
具体实施例方式下面结合附图和实施例对本发明作进一步的描述。实现不同种类即时通信工具互通的方法的第一实施例图1示出了本发明的实现不同种类即时通信工具互通的方法的第一实施例的流程。请参见图1,本实施例的实现不同种类即时通信工具互通的方法包括以下的步骤。步骤SlO 架设即时通信交换中心,即时通信交换中心申请多个不同种类的即时通信帐号。这些不同种类的即时通信帐号所对应的工具包括QQ、MSN、Skype、飞信等,但不限于列出的这些即时通信工具。步骤Sll 即时通信交换中心运行多个不同种类的即时通信客户端,连接到相应的即时通信服务器,并向自己的用户提供即时通信交换服务。
步骤S12 第一用户(用户A)在即时通信交换中心注册用户名和自己的即时通信工具的种类和帐号。用户A在注册自己的即时通信工具的种类和帐号时,将即时通信交换中心提供的该种即时通信服务帐号加为好友或者联系人,以便使用后续即时通信交换中心提供的服务。步骤S13 用户A用注册的所述即时通信工具和帐号,与即时通信交换中心通信, 指定作为通信对方的第二用户(用户B)在即时通信交换中心的用户名。步骤S14 即时通信交换中心根据用户B的用户名查询其即时通信工具的种类和帐号。步骤S15 即时通信交换中心通知用户B有关用户A的通信请求。步骤S16 用户B同意用户A的通信请求后,双方开始通信,即时通信交换中心在中间交换和中继双方的通信内容。这里的交换和中继双方的通信内容的步骤进一步包括用户A在其第一即时通信工具甲上输入通信内容,发送到即时通信交换中心的第一即时通信工具甲的服务帐号上。即时通信交换中心获取到用户A在第一即时通信工具甲上发送的通信内容后,将其发送到用户B的第二即时通信工具乙上。用户B在第二即时通信工具乙上输入通信内容,发送到即时通信交换中心的第二即时通信工具乙的服务帐号上。即时通信交换中心获取到用户B在第二即时通信工具乙上发送的通信内容后,将其发送到用户A的第一即时通信工具上。实现不同即时通信工具互通的方法的第二实施例图2示出了本发明的实现不同即时通信工具互通的方法的第二实施例的流程。请参见图2,本实施例的实现不同即时通信工具互通的方法包括以下的步骤。步骤S20 架设即时通信交换中心,即时通信交换中心申请多个不同种类的即时通信帐号。这些不同种类的即时通信帐号所对应的工具包括QQ、MSN、Skype、飞信等,但不限于列出的这些即时通信工具。步骤S21 即时通信交换中心运行多个不同种类的即时通信客户端,连接到相应的即时通信服务器,并向自己的用户提供即时通信交换服务。步骤S22 第一用户(用户A)在即时通信交换中心注册用户名和自己的即时通信工具的种类和帐号。用户A在注册自己的即时通信工具的种类和帐号时,将即时通信交换中心提供的即时通信服务帐号加为好友,以便使用后续即时通信交换中心提供的服务。步骤S23 用户A用注册的所述即时通信工具和帐号,与即时通信交换中心通信, 指定作为通信对方的第二用户(用户B)即时通信工具的种类和帐号。步骤S24 即时通信交换中心通知用户B有关用户A的通信请求。步骤S25 用户B同意用户A的通信请求后,双方开始通信,即时通信交换中心在中间交换和中继双方的通信内容。
这里的交换和中继双方的通信内容的步骤进一步包括用户A在其第一即时通信工具甲上输入通信内容,发送到即时通信交换中心的第一即时通信工具甲的服务帐号上。即时通信交换中心获取到用户A在第一即时通信工具甲上发送的通信内容后,将其发送到用户B的第二即时通信工具乙上。用户B在第二即时通信工具乙上输入通信内容,发送到即时通信交换中心的第二即时通信工具乙的服务帐号上。即时通信交换中心获取到用户B在第二即时通信工具乙上发送的通信内容后,将其发送到用户A的第一即时通信工具上。实现不同种类即时通信工具互通的系统的实施例图3示出了本发明的实现不同种类即时通信工具互通的系统的实施例的结构。请参见图3,本实施例的系统包括多个客户端(在本实施例中示出为客户端A和客户端B)、多个即时通信交换中心(在本实施例中示出为即时通信交换中心A端和即时通信交换中心B 端)、多个即时通信服务器(在本实施例中示出为QQ服务器、MSN服务器、Skype服务器和飞信服务器)。这些客户端分属于多种不同的即时通信工具(例如QQ、MSN等)。这些即时通信服务器也分属于多种不同的即时通信工具。即时通信交换中心设置多个不同种类即时通信工具的交换和中继模块(QQ交换和中继模块、MSN交换和中继模块、Skype交换和中继模块和飞信交换和中继模块),每一交换和中继模块和对应的即时通信服务器建立通信连接,即时通信交换中心在不同种类的即时通信工具的即时通信服务器之间交换和中继双方的通信内容。整个系统的运行流程如图1和2所示,在上述实施例中已有描述,在此不再赘述。上述实施例是提供给本领域普通技术人员来实现和使用本发明的,本领域普通技术人员可在不脱离本发明的发明思想的情况下,对上述实施例做出种种修改或变化,因而本发明的发明范围并不被上述实施例所限,而应该是符合权利要求书所提到的创新性特征的最大范围。
8
权利要求
1.一种实现不同种类即时通信工具互通的方法,包括步骤1 架设即时通信交换中心,支持多种不同的即时通信工具;步骤2 第一用户在所述即时通信交换中心注册用户名和自己的即时通信工具的种类和帐号;步骤3 所述第一用户用注册的所述即时通信工具和所述帐号与所述即时通信交换中心通信,指定作为通信对方的第二用户在所述即时通信交换中心的用户名或者所述第二用户的即时通信工具的种类和帐号;步骤4 所述即时通信交换中心通知所述第二用户有关所述第一用户的通信请求;步骤5 所述第二用户同意所述第一用户的通信请求,双方开始通信,所述即时通信交换中心在中间交换和中继双方的通信内容。
2.根据权利要求1所述的实现不同种类即时通信工具互通的方法,其特征在于,所述步骤1包括步骤1. 1 所述即时通信交换中心申请多个不同种类的即时通信帐号;步骤1. 2 所述即时通信交换中心运行多个不同种类的即时通信客户端,连接到相应的即时通信服务器,并向自己的用户提供即时通信交换服务。
3.根据权利要求1所述的实现不同种类即时通信工具互通的方法,其特征在于,所述步骤2包括所述第一用户在注册自己的即时通信工具的种类和帐号时,将所述即时通信交换中心提供的该种即时通信服务帐号加为好友或者联系人,以便使用后续所述即时通信交换中心提供的服务。
4.根据权利要求1所述的实现不同种类即时通信工具互通的方法,其特征在于,所述步骤3包括步骤3. 1 所述第一用户使用注册的即时通信工具和帐号,与所述即时通信交换中心的与所述第一用户所使用的所述即时通信工具属于相同种类的即时通信服务帐号通信;步骤3. 2:所述第一用户用所述即时通信工具,指定所述第二用户在所述即时通信交换中心的用户名或者所述第二用户的即时通信工具的种类和帐号。
5.根据权利要求1所述的实现不同种类即时通信工具互通的方法,其特征在于,所述步骤4包括以下两种情况中的其中一种所述即时通信交换中心根据所述第一用户提供的所述第二用户的用户名在所述即时通信交换中心查询所述第二用户的即时通信工具的种类和帐号,然后在查询到的即时通信工具和帐号上将所述第一用户的通信请求通知给所述第二用户;或者所述即时通信交换中心根据所述第一用户提供的所述第二用户的即时通信工具的种类和帐号,在所述第二用户相应的所述即时通信工具和帐号上将所述第一用户的通信请求通知给所述第二用户。
6.根据权利要求1所述的实现不同种类即时通信工具互通的方法,其特征在于,所述步骤5包括步骤5. 1 所述第一用户在其第一即时通信工具上输入通信内容,发送到所述即时通信交换中心的所述第一即时通信工具的服务帐号上;步骤5. 2 所述即时通信交换中心获取到所述第一用户在所述第一即时通信工具上发送的通信内容后,将其发送到所述第二用户的第二即时通信工具上;步骤5. 3:所述第二用户在所述第二即时通信工具上输入通信内容,发送到所述即时通信交换中心的所述第二即时通信工具的服务帐号上;步骤5. 4 所述即时通信交换中心获取到所述第二用户在所述第二即时通信工具上发送的通信内容后,将其发送到所述第一用户的所述第一即时通信工具上。
7.根据权利要求1 6中任一项所述的实现不同种类即时通信工具互通的方法,其特征在于,所述多种不同的即时通信工具包括QQ、MSN、Skype、飞信。
8.一种实现不同种类即时通信工具互通的系统,包括多个客户端,包括安装版,网页版或者手机版,分属于多种不同的即时通信工具;多个即时通信服务器,分属于多种不同的即时通信工具,与其对应的客户端之间建立通信连接;即时通信交换中心,其中设置多个对应不同种类即时通信工具的交换和中继模块,每一交换和中继模块和对应的所述多个即时通信服务器建立通信连接,所述即时通信交换中心在不同种类的即时通信工具的即时通信服务器之间交换和中继双方的通信内容。
9.根据权利要求8所述的实现不同种类即时通信工具互通的系统,其特征在于,所述多种不同的即时通信工具包括QQ、MSN、Skype、飞信。
全文摘要
本发明公开了实现不同种类即时通讯工具互通的方法和系统,方便网络用户间的即时通信,使用户可以只选择自己偏好的即时通信工具,又可跟其它种类的即时通信工具互联。其技术方案为方法包括架设即时通信交换中心,支持多种不同的即时通信工具;第一用户在即时通信交换中心注册用户名和自己的即时通信工具的种类和帐号;第一用户用注册的即时通信工具和帐号与所述即时通信交换中心通信,指定作为通信对方的第二用户在即时通信交换中心的用户名或者第二用户的即时通信工具的种类和帐号;即时通信交换中心通知第二用户有关第一用户的通信请求;第二用户同意第一用户的通信请求,双方开始通信,即时通信交换中心在中间交换和中继双方的通信内容。
文档编号H04L12/58GK102202015SQ201110153210
公开日2011年9月28日 申请日期2011年6月9日 优先权日2011年6月9日
发明者张李影 申请人:张李影
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1